I was late on the "Delirious?" train. They were a British Christian Rock band that found radio play on Christian stations here in the States. I liked what I heard, but never really "got into them", even when they started churning out worship hits like "Did You Feel the Mountains Tremble?" and "I Could Sing of Your Love Forever".

I knew worship leader friends of mine who liked them and used their songs in chapel band in college and in their youth groups. I'm not sure if it was because their name confused me - was it 'Delirious', 'Deliriou5?', or 'Delirous?'  (it was the latter). Or maybe it was because their radio songs didn't strike me as super-profound, but I wasn't a real big fan.

Turns out, it was my loss. I pride myself on having good musical tastes, but I missed the boat on this one. And the song that changed my mind was this one:
